Thomas Richard Busby 1538–1584 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 1538

Birth Location: East Claydon, Buckinghamshire, England

Death Date: 1584

Death Location: Stafford, Staffordshire, England

Father: Richard Busby

Mother: Rebekah Busby

Spouse(s): Alice Esterfield

Children(s): John *7*

In 1538, Thomas Richard Busby entered the world in East Claydon, Buckinghamshire, England, born to Richard Busby And Rebekah Busby. Thomas Richard Busby married Alice Esterfield, and had children including John Busby 7. Thomas Richard Busby passed away in 1584 in Stafford, Staffordshire, England.
